Abstract
The present disclosure provides a solar cell assembly, comprising a front plate, a front glue film layer, a cell piece array, a back glue film layer and a back plate which are sequentially stacked, wherein the front plate comprises glass, a side, deviating from the cell piece array, of the glass is provided with one or more light scattering units, and each light scattering unit is of a sunken structure formed when the side, deviating from the cell piece array, of the glass is sunken inwards towards a side, adjacent to the cell piece array, of the glass. The present disclosure provides that the light scattering unit is not needed to correspond to a non-gate line portion of a cell piece, a requirement for type correspondence of the glass and the cell piece is not high, it is guaranteed that a whole silicon wafer can utilize incident light rays very well, a light receiving area of the glass is increased, assembly power is improved, and assembly installing cost is lowered.

[0037] The depth of the sunken structure of the present disclosure is at a millimeter level, an anti-reflection effect in the natural environment is stable, self-cleaning performance is better, and a surface is easy to clean. Different from a nanometer level depth of the sunken structure, the nanometer level sunken depth is a very small ion corrosion pit in essence, an anti-reflection contribution of a fine corrosion pit to light is small, the fine corrosion pit is prone to be gradually corroded and ground flat in an environment of sun scorching, rain drenching, wind and sand, and then the anti-reflection effect is reduced; and dirt and other impurities accumulated in a groove of a nanometer structure are not removed easily, and a utilizing rare of the light is further affected.

[0041] When sunlight penetrates through the solar cell glass 1 and is irradiated onto one side of the solar cell piece array 3, the solar cell piece array 3 generates a photovoltaic effect, not all the sunlight irradiated onto the cell piece array 3 is utilized, and much of the sunlight is reflected by the cell piece array 3. When the light reflected out of the cell piece array 3 is reflected to one side of the light scattering units 11 of the sunken structure, the light is reflected and scattered onto one side of the cell piece array 3 again, and participates in power generation again. The process is repeatedly performed heaps of times, therefore, it is guaranteed that the whole silicon wafer can utilize incident light rays very well, that the light receiving area of the glass 1 is increased, and that the assembly power is improved. By adopting the solar cell assembly of the present disclosure, sunlight in various time periods of one day may also be effectively utilized without adopting a sun chasing system, and cell assembly installing cost is lowered.
[0042] Unlike the present disclosure, CN 101677112A in the prior art is a light concentrating principle of convex type light concentrating glass in common use in the field, the light rays are focused on one point by penetrating through the glass. And in actual production, on the one hand, it is needed to consider that convex patterns of the glass need to correspond to a cell piece between fine gate lines (a width of a strip-shaped reflecting light concentrating surface is 0.6 mm to 1.2 mm); on the other hand, correspondence of types of the glass and the cell piece needs to be considered, it is avoided that deviation exists during layout and arrangement of the assembly, the light rays are focused on the gate lines, and then are reflected, and then there are negative effects on improvement of the assembly power. The technical solution of the present disclosure applies a light scattering principle, the light rays are uniform, the light scattering units arranged on the glass enable the front plate to increase an effective reflecting and light scattering surface area on the light receiving surface, a utilizing rate of solar energy is increased, and therefore, the output power of the cell assembly is improved, technical problems existing in CN 101677112A in the prior art are solved, and meanwhile, an experiment proves that the output power is improved by 3% compared with CN 101677112A in the prior art.
